Optical Encoder Position Sensing Solutions

Analog Devices Inc. Optical Encoder Position Sensing Solutions feature highly accurate optical encoders that provide rotary and linear position feedback with resolution up to 26 bits. The optical encoders use a photosensor to detect light through a disk. Sine and cosine signals are interpolated to improve resolution. The encoder resolution is determined by the number of slots and the interpolation resolution. The Analog Devices Optical Encoders provide scalable solutions in both size and resolution.

Position Sensing Interface Solutions

Analog Devices Inc. Position Sensing Interface Solutions are designed for closed-loop mechanical control systems across a wide range of industries including automotive, industrial automation, process control, and military and aerospace. These sensors can measure the position of various mechanical systems. Some of these measurements include the position of the robot arm, angular position of electric motor shaft, linear displacement of a hydraulic valve, and position of aircraft flight control surfaces.

AD7264 Simultaneous Sampling SAR ADCs

Analog Devices AD7264 Simultaneous Sampling SAR ADCs are dual, 14-bit, high speed, low power, successive approximation ADCs. The AD7264 operates from a single 5V power supply and features throughput rates of up to 1MSPS per on-chip ADC. Two complete ADC functions allow simultaneous sampling and conversion of two channels. Each ADC is preceded by a true differential analog input with a PGA. There are 14 gain settings available: ×1, ×2, ×3, ×4, ×6, ×8, ×12, ×16, ×24, ×32, ×48, ×64, ×96, and ×128.
